The most direct way to blend reading with gaming is to use characters as the pieces. Instead of generic discs, imagine a set of thirty-two markers featuring beloved characters from iconic literature. The “dark” pieces could represent villains like Professor Moriarty, Captain Hook, or Sauron, while the “light” pieces feature heroes such as Sherlock Holmes, Wendy Darling, or Frodo Baggins. These pieces can be crafted from sturdy cardstock affixed to wooden coins, or custom 3D-printed miniatures for a more immersive feel. As a player, capturing an opponent’s piece feels like a strategic triumph over an antagonistic force. The board itself is a canvas for literary creativity. Instead of a standard red and black grid, the game board can be redesigned to reflect a favorite genre. A fantasy-themed board might feature a map of Middle-earth or Westeros, with pieces representing different factions rather than just colors. For mystery enthusiasts, the board could be styled to look like a vintage detective’s desk, covered with case files and magnifying glasses. Sci-fi lovers might prefer a board that represents a galaxy map, turning every jump to a new square into a voyage through the stars. Themed “Library” Checkers Set
Perhaps the most charming idea is a set themed around the library itself. The board could be designed to look like a polished wooden tabletop, with the squares styled as miniature, leather-bound book spines. The pieces could be little, carved objects: quills, inkwells, magnifying glasses, or spectacles. Instead of just jumping, the action feels like a careful curation of literary tools. “Crowning” a piece could involve placing a small, gold-leafed book token on top. This approach brings a cozy, academic feel to the game, perfectly suited for an evening by the fire. It treats the game of checkers not just as a competition, but as a celebratory activity focused on the love of reading and the physical joy of books.
